Background
The processing object of the drilling automatic line is a power transmission line iron tower which takes angle steel as a main component and is connected by a rough bolt.
The angle steel is required to be subjected to blanking conveying after the drilling is finished, so that the subsequent drilling operation of the angle steel is facilitated. The existing blanking frame can only convey the angle steel, is single in function, cannot arrange the angle steel, and also needs to use independent equipment to position and arrange the angle steel in subsequent processes, so that the operation is complex, and the occupied space is large.

When in use:
in the initial state, the first support plate 31 and the second support plate 8 are both located on the lower side;
when the angle steel falls on the first support plate 31 and the second support plate 8, the electric push rod 41 and the servo motor 6 are controlled to work through an external switch group;
the electric push rod 41 drives the mounting plate 42 to move, the mounting plate 42 can drive the push plate 51 to move through the shock absorber 53, the push plate 51 can push the angle steel, and meanwhile, the push plate 51 is matched with the circular plate 2 to extrude the angle steel;
servo motor 6 drives push pedal 51 and rotates, and push pedal 51 drives the angle steel through slipmat 7 and rotates, and when the angle steel aligns with right angle hole 21, the angle steel slides into inside right angle delivery board 1, and roller bearing 9 reduces the friction between angle steel and the right angle delivery board 1.
